A portable power supply 10 has an electrical generator 30, a charge store 40, and a rapid charging circuit 50 for charging a secondary cell 80 in a portable electronic device 20. The supply 10 thus allows the device 20 to be rapidly recharged and then disconnected from the supply 10, whereby portability of the device 20 is not sacrificed. The generator 30 may be a manually operated generator, a fuel cell, or particularly a solar cell. The charge store 40 may be a capacitor, or particularly a secondary cell. The circuit 50 may provide constant current and/or constant voltage charging. The charge state of the cell 40 may be indicated by a display (41c, or 42c, Figs.8,9) controlled by a circuit responsive to cell current and/or voltage. An LED (45, Fig.13) may be provided to indicate that the solar cell 30 is generating. A discharger (43 or 44, Figs.10-12) may be provided for discharging cell 40 to prevent memory effect. The discharger may be controlled manually, or by means of a circuit responsive to the number of times the cell 40 has discharged to the device 20, or responsive to integration of the charge and/or discharge time periods of the cell 40. The cell 40 may be charged from the solar cell 30 via a constant current or constant voltage charger circuit (46, Fig.14). The cell 40 may be housed in a case (11, Figs.5,6) having a fold-up solar cell array (12). The supply 10 may have a spring-loaded reel (17, Fig.7) for winding up a power cord (15) by means of which the supply 10 can be releasably connected to the device 20. The portable device 20 may be a communication device, such as a telephone, or a personal computer. |
